Gorilla Jobs is seeking a Dental Therapist for a fully private practice in Wigton, Cumbria. This role allows you to work within your full scope in a supportive team environment and offers a competitive hourly rate of £36-£40 depending on experience.

The practice emphasizes a collaborative approach, focuses on CPD and offers flexible working hours.
